The Foundation of Sweden's Green Policies
Historical Context
Sweden's commitment to environmental protection dates back several decades, with early legislation focusing on air and water quality. This long-standing dedication has created a culture of sustainability and innovation, making Sweden a model for other nations.
Key Legislation
Several pivotal laws underpin Sweden's environmental efforts, including the Environmental Code and various acts related to energy and climate. These laws set stringent standards and provide a framework for sustainable development.
🇸🇪 Renewable Energy Initiatives
Investment in Renewables
Sweden has heavily invested in renewable energy sources such as hydropower, wind power, and biomass. These investments have significantly reduced the country's reliance on fossil fuels.
Wind Power Expansion
Wind power is a rapidly growing sector in Sweden, with numerous wind farms dotting the landscape. Government incentives and technological advancements have fueled this expansion.
Hydropower Dominance
Hydropower remains a significant source of electricity in Sweden, providing a stable and renewable energy supply. Efforts are underway to modernize existing hydropower plants and minimize their environmental impact.
Biomass Utilization
Sweden is a leader in biomass utilization, converting forestry residues and other organic materials into energy. This approach reduces waste and provides a sustainable alternative to fossil fuels.
♻️ Waste Management and Recycling
Advanced Recycling Programs
Sweden boasts one of the most advanced recycling programs in the world, with a high percentage of waste being recycled or incinerated for energy recovery. This minimizes landfill waste and conserves resources.
Deposit Refund System
The deposit refund system for bottles and cans incentivizes recycling and reduces litter. This system has been highly successful in promoting responsible waste disposal.
Waste-to-Energy Technology
Sweden has invested heavily in waste-to-energy technology, which converts non-recyclable waste into heat and electricity. This reduces reliance on fossil fuels and minimizes environmental impact.
🌿 Conservation of Natural Resources
Forest Management
Sustainable forest management is a priority in Sweden, ensuring that forests are harvested responsibly and replanted to maintain biodiversity and carbon sequestration. This is crucial as Sweden is a heavily forested country. Forests also tie into Sweden's biomass utilization and exports.
Protected Areas
Sweden has established numerous national parks and nature reserves to protect biodiversity and preserve natural habitats. These areas provide refuge for endangered species and offer opportunities for outdoor recreation.
Water Resource Management
Sweden is committed to protecting its water resources through strict regulations and monitoring programs. These efforts ensure clean and sustainable water supplies for both human consumption and ecosystem health.
💰 Economic Incentives and Green Policies
Carbon Tax
Sweden was one of the first countries to introduce a carbon tax, which incentivizes businesses and individuals to reduce their carbon emissions. This tax has been instrumental in driving down emissions and promoting green technologies.
Green Bonds
The Swedish government has issued green bonds to finance environmentally friendly projects, such as renewable energy and sustainable transportation. These bonds attract investors who are committed to sustainability.
Subsidies and Grants
Sweden provides subsidies and grants to support the development and deployment of green technologies. These incentives encourage innovation and accelerate the transition to a low-carbon economy.

Looking Ahead: Future Goals
Ambitious Climate Targets
Sweden has set ambitious climate targets for the future, including becoming carbon neutral by 2045. These goals require continued innovation and investment in green technologies.
Sustainable Transportation
Sweden is promoting sustainable transportation through investments in electric vehicles, public transportation, and cycling infrastructure. These efforts aim to reduce emissions from the transportation sector.
Circular Economy
Sweden is embracing the concept of a circular economy, which emphasizes waste reduction, reuse, and recycling. This approach aims to minimize resource consumption and environmental impact.
